2017-01-02 68 views
0

我想保存在Windows中的文件並找到文件類, 一個問題,當我上傳文件,我得到這個錯誤拒絕的權限:Laravel文件把在Windows

ErrorException in Filesystem.php line 111: file_put_contents(./upload/Bambui/2016): failed to open stream: Permission denied

,這是我的功能來保存文件:

public function save() 
    { 
     $input = Input::only('empresa','tipo','data','data_pub','deliberacao','status','num_registro','publicacao','arquivo'); 

     $diretorio = $this->atas->checkAndCreateDirectory($input['empresa'], substr($input['data'], 6, 4)); 

     File::put($diretorio, $input['arquivo']); 
    } 

本人同意在我的wamp文件夾的所有用戶編寫和也看了。

+0

並在該文件夾真的存在嗎? – Beginner

+0

嘗試在「C:\ wamp \ bin \ apache \ apache2.4.9 \ conf」中取消註釋「LoadModule rewrite_module modules/mod_rewrite.so」以查找文件「httpd.conf」。 –

+0

耶存在公用文件夾 –

回答

0

THX的幫助,我發現自己的答案,更改文件類存儲,這樣做,

Storage::putFileAs('pdf/'.substr($input['data'], 6, 4), $input['arquivo'], $filename); 

和工作